Does meditation have a place in the military?

According to an article in The Huffington Post, meditation may help soldiers do more than cope with stress. It may also have the potential to help them perform their duties more effectively.

Portable MP3 players loaded with guided imagery audio tracks were sent to soldiers in Iraq and Afghanistan with the goal of helping them cope better with stress and sleep issues.

The active duty soldiers not only liked the players, but service people in resilience training reported needing to achieve a state of "calm, detached focus" to fulfill roles the rest of us wouldn't dare--roles like bomb defuser, sniper or special ops. Given that meditation is intended to achieve that exact state of mind and being, it's possible that meditation may enhance soldiers' performance during active duty.
